Calculating Your Bonus

Let us walk through a realistic scenario to understand how the mrvegas bonus works. Suppose the welcome offer is a 100% match up to €100 plus 20 free spins. You decide to deposit €50. Your bonus would be 100% of €50 = €50, so your total starting balance becomes €100 (your deposit plus the bonus). The free spins are credited separately.

Now consider the wagering requirement. Common terms include a 35x requirement on the bonus amount, and sometimes on the deposit plus bonus. We will calculate for both cases. Formula: total amount to wager = (deposit + bonus) × wagering multiplier, or bonus × wagering multiplier, depending on the terms.

Case 1: Wagering on bonus only. Wagering amount = €50 × 35 = €1,750. You need to place bets totaling €1,750 before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us.

Case 2: Wagering on deposit plus bonus. Wagering amount = (€50 + €50) × 35 = €100 × 35 = €3,500. This is exactly double, as the deposit is included. Always check which base the casino uses.

Let us also factor in game contribution rates. For example, slots typically contribute 100% to wagering, meaning every €1 wagered on slots counts as €1 toward the requirement. Table games like blackjack or roulette often contribute only 10% or even 0%. If you wager €100 on blackjack with a 10% contribution rate, it counts as just €10 toward the wagering requirement. That can extend the time needed to clear the bonus significantly.

Let us assume you are playing slots exclusively with a 100% contribution rate and a bonus-only requirement of €1,750. If your average bet is €2 per spin, you would need to place 1,750 / 2 = 875 spins to meet the requirement. If each spin takes about 3 seconds, that is 875 × 3 = 2,625 seconds, or just over 43 minutes of continuous play—assuming you never lose your balance. In reality, your bankroll will fluctuate, so you may need multiple sessions.

Important: If the wagering requirement is not met within the specified time (often 30 days), the bonus and any winnings from it may be forfeited. Always set a calendar reminder if you plan to clear a large requirement.

Licence & Player Protection

The casino operates under a licence issued by the Government of Curacao. This is a common arrangement for many online operators, especially those targeting international players. A Curacao licence means the casino is regulated for basic fairness and security, but it does not offer the same level of player protection as, say, a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or UK Gambling Commission licence.

What does this mean for you? First, you have a recourse path: if a dispute arises, you can contact the Curacao licensing authority, though the process may be slow. Second, and more importantly for tax purposes: if you reside in the European Union or the Nordic region, winnings from a Curacao-licensed casino are typically considered taxable income in your country of residence. Unlike MGA-licensed casinos, which are based in Malta and often fall under specific EU tax directives, Curacao operators do not withhold taxes. You must declare your winnings in your annual tax return. This is a user tip: keep a record of your deposits, withdrawals, and net winnings for tax season.

Good to Know

As a general rule, online slots are the most generous game category in terms of return-to-player (RTP). Look for slots with RTP percentages of 96% or higher, such as those from providers like NetEnt or Play’n GO. In contrast, progressive jackpot slots often have lower baseline RTP (around 92–94%) because the house edge funds the growing jackpot. Table games like blackjack can have a very low house edge if you play basic strategy—often under 1%, which translates to an RTP of 99% or higher. However, in this casino, as in many curacao-licensed sites, table games contribute only a fraction to wagering requirements, so they are not efficient for clearing bonuses. For bonus clearing, stick to high-RTP slots with a 100% contribution rate. Avoid three-reel slots with poorly documented RTP if you are chasing a bonus, as their actual return is often lower.
